A new method for analyzing H5N1 avian influenza virus

In this paper a novel method for phylogenetic analysis of H5N1 avian influenza virus has been proposed. At first we provide a mapping of virus protein sequence. Based on this mapping, we propose a new distance measure and make use of the corresponding similarity matrix to construct phylogenic tree without requiring multiple alignment. As an application, we construct phylogenic tree for 123 species of H5N1 avian influenza virus. The phylogeny obtained is generally consistent with evolutionary trees constructed in previous studies.
